Inverse Synthetic Aperture Radar(ISAR)is a high resolution microwave imagingsystem. It has great prospects in target recognition,anti-stealth,astronomy and airtraffic control etc. It is an important research direction in radar imaging area. SinceISAR has prominent performances and wide military applications, it is urgent to studyjamming methods against ISAR, the work is important to technical modernization ofnational defence.In order to study jamming methods against ISAR, we should master imagingprinciple and imaging algorithms of ISAR, which provide the foundation for study ofjamming methods of ISAR. Based on the theory of ISAR imaging, the dissertation focuson jamming technique and realization methods.The realization methods of ISAR radarjammer have been designed, and results of experiment have been analyzed. The maincontent of this dissertation are summarized as follows.Firstly,the theory of ISAR imaging is studied. Target echo theory model and aspecial processing method (Dechirping)in range imaging have been researched.Motion compensation of principle including the range alignment and phase correct ofcorrelated movement are discussed. Range-Doppler(R-D) imaging algorithm of ISARhave been analyzed.Secondly,jamming techniques of ISAR are studied. Based on the jamming theoryof ISAR, some coherent and incoherent jamming methods including Radiofrequency(RF) noise jamming, frequency shift jamming and three type offrequency_modulated jamming are discussed in detail. The effects on the ISAR radarare simulated.Finally, realization methods of ISAR jammer are analyzed in detail and proposedimplementation of ISAR jammer. From functional principle to implementation methodsof different components of the jammer have been discussed comprehensively. Thesoftware scheme of master controller have been designed. The whole work process hasbeen divided into several software modules, the working process and flow chat of eachmodule are given. The correctness and effectiveness of jamming methods and design ofthe system are verified by the lab experimental results of of ISAR jammer.
